Output 85b17618fac649ca840afbb87cdcd157ff40ad998db642f1bc6a4970d22639ae:1

value
2108260
script pubkey
OP_0 OP_PUSHBYTES_32 217a3e2d11db8063729e9fbeaa2f7450c1ce4312b62d2fd6021dd90b09f09d21
address
bc1qy9arutg3mwqxxu57n7l25tm52rquuscjkckjl4szrhvskz0sn5ssg9pdun
transaction
85b17618fac649ca840afbb87cdcd157ff40ad998db642f1bc6a4970d22639ae
confirmations
503
spent
true